CVE-2024-34244
Last modified
CVE-2024-34244 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. libmodbus v3.1.10 is vulnerable to Buffer Overflow via the modbus_write_bits function. This issue can be triggered when the function is fed with specially crafted input, which leads to out-of-bounds read and can potentially cause a crash or other unintended behaviors.. EPSS estimates a 0.52%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
